Evidence for ambiphilic behavior in (CO)5W=NPh. Conversion of carbonyl compounds to N-phenyl imines via metathesis
Arndtsen, Bruce A.,Sleiman, Hanadi F.,Chang, Andrew K.,McElwee-White, Lisa
, p. 4871 - 4876 (2007/10/02)
(CO)5 W=NPh (5) has been generated in the presence of aldehydes, ketones, and thioketones and found to undergo metathesis with these substrates to yield N-phenyl imines. The participation of complex 5 as a nucleophile in these reactions and the previously reported reaction of 5 with PPh3 confirm the ambiphilic nature of (CO)5W=NPh. This is consistent with the electronic structure of the model compound (CO)5W=NMe, as obtained from extended Hückel calculations. The heteroatom-substituted nitrene complex (CO)5W=NNMe2 (7) is less electrophilic but still functions as a nucleophile in its reaction with PhCHO to give Me2NN=CHPh.
